Biography

Nikolai Durovtech (telegram coder) with roots in the USSR

Nikolai Durov is a Russian mathematician and programmer born in Leningrad who co-founded VKontakte (Russia's Facebook) with his brother Pavel Durov, and then co-developed the technical architecture of Telegram. One of the most gifted programmers of his generation, he designed the MTProto encryption protocol that underpins Telegram's security.

Russian Connection

Tracing the roots — Leningrad

Born in Leningrad in 1980 and educated at St. Petersburg State University — where he won multiple international mathematical olympiads — Nikolai is the technical genius behind the Durov brothers' digital empire. His mathematical background and his Soviet-Russian intellectual formation directly shaped the cryptographic foundations of Telegram, used by hundreds of millions worldwide.

Key Achievements

A career defined by ambition

01
Co-founded VKontakte (VK) with brother Pavel Durov
02
Designed MTProto encryption protocol — the cryptographic foundation of Telegram
03
International Mathematical Olympiad gold medallist
04
St. Petersburg State University — multiple international prizes in mathematics and programming
05
Co-architected Telegram's technical infrastructure for 900+ million users
